Update:

I sent the 15sec audio clip of the distortion to Burson Audio sales couple of days ago. Their tech team determined the opamps are defective and they are cross shipping me the replacement. They asked me to ship by sea to save the shipping cost.. These opamps come with "lifetime" warranty.

Nice company.

Glad to here it was the opamps. That was easy. Burson is top notch on service, though shipping can be slow from Australia. I had an experience where I had ordered single opamps modules but they shipped dual opamps. I did not realize that initially, and found they did not work properly and set them aside. I later contacted them about it, and they shipped me the singles and told me to keep the dual opamps since it was their mistake.
